Description
Regent Ratchada Tower is a high-rise condominium located at 32 Din Daeng Subdistrict, Din Daeng District, Bangkok 10400. The project sits in the early Ratchadaphisek area near Sutthisan and Huai Khwang, a well-established urban neighborhood with convenient access to the city and a wide range of nearby amenities, making it suitable for both owner-occupiers and long-term rental demand.
The project consists of 1 residential building with 24 floors and approximately 231 units. Parking is available within the development. Unit types mainly include studio and 1-bedroom layouts, with practical living space suited for 1-2 residents, reflecting the classic inner-city condominium style of the Ratchada area.
Common facilities generally include a lobby, passenger lifts, parking area, and basic shared spaces. Security systems include security guards, CCTV, and controlled building access.
The project was completed around 1992. As a long-standing condominium in the market, its main strength lies in the location, with convenient access to Ratchadaphisek Road and surrounding city facilities. Building management is handled by the condominium juristic person. However, the developer's name could not be clearly verified from publicly available sources.
In terms of transportation, the project is located near MRT Sutthisan and MRT Huai Khwang, with easy connections to Ratchadaphisek Road, Sutthisan Winitchai Road, and routes toward Rama 9, Asok, and Lat Phrao. The surrounding area includes restaurants, office buildings, local markets, and lifestyle destinations in the Ratchada zone.

Price Trend
Regent Ratchada Tower (Din Daeng-Ratchadaphisek) is typically driven by practical rental demand from office workers around Rama 9-Ratchada and nearby campuses. It is not a “walk-to-train” condo: MRT Thailand Cultural Centre is about 2.0 km away and MRT Huai Khwang about 2.4 km (by car), so pricing and room condition are key to liquidity.
- Resale price in 2026: Studio to 1-bed (28-32 sq.m.) averages 1.65-2.05M THB, or roughly 58,000-70,000 THB per sq.m. Fully furnished units tend to sit at the upper end.
- Average rent: 7,500-9,500 THB per month (studio) and 9,500-12,000 THB per month (1-bed), depending on renovation and appliances.
- Rental Yield: Example 30 sq.m. unit priced at 1.80M THB, rented at 9,000 THB per month. Annual rent = 108,000 THB. Yield = 108,000 / 1,800,000 = 6.0% gross (before common fees, vacancy, and agent costs).
Capital Gain outlook: Because the project is not within easy walking distance to MRT, price appreciation is usually gradual rather than sharp. Using a 2024-2026 range of 2-4% per year, a 1.80M THB unit may move to about 1.87-1.95M THB. Upside is more “value-add” driven: renovation quality, furniture package, and competitive positioning versus nearby alternatives such as Ivy Ratchada and The Kris 2 Ratchada 17.
